Fetal stomach diameter measurements
PREPARATION
Full bladder for transabdominal imaging in 2
nd
trimester.
POSITION
Mother is in the supine position. Transverse and sagittal images through the fetal stomach are obtained.
TRANSDUCER
Transabdominal: 3.0–6.0 MHz curvilinear transducer.
METHOD
Maximum long axis, transverse, and anteroposterior diameters are obtained.
APPEARANCE
Normal fetal stomach appears as a uid-lled structure on left side of the abdomen. It should be seen by 13 weeks of gestation. An enlarged stomach is associated with duodenal atresia.

Fetal colon measurement
PREPARATION
Full bladder for transabdominal imaging in 2
nd
trimester.
POSITION
Mother is in the supine position. Sagittal view through fetal transverse colon at the maximum diameter is obtained.
TRANSDUCER
Transabdominal: 3.0–6.0 MHz curvilinear transducer.
METHOD
The colon is measured from outer-to-outer margin. A dilated colon is associated with Hirschsprung’s disease, volvulus, and colonic atresia or any other distal obstruction.
APPEARANCE
The lumen of a normal colon is reliably visualized after 25 weeks with characteristic colonic haustra. An echogenic bowel that appears as bright as bone at low gain is associated with Down syndrome, cystic brosis, intrauterine growth retardation (IUGR), or congenital infec­tions.

Fetal small bowel measurements
PREPARATION
Full bladder for transabdominal imaging in 2
nd
trimester.
POSITION
Mother is in the supine position. Short axis image of uid-lled small bowel of the fetus.
TRANSDUCER
Transabdominal: 3.0–6.0 MHz curvilinear transducer.
METHOD
Maximum transverse diameter of fetal small bowel from outer to outer edge is taken.
A dilated small bowel is associated with volvulus; meconium ileus; and jejunal, ileal, or colonic atresia. Cystic brosis should be considered in all fetuses with bowel abnormalities.
APPEARANCE
The uid-containing lumen of the small bowel is normally seen after 20 weeks. Hyperperistalsis and hyperechoic bowel are considered abnor­mal. (Hyperperistalsis is dened by nearly constant movement of the bowel wall during real-time scanning; hyperechoic bowel is dened as a bowel that appears as echogenic as bone).

The presence of dilated loops of bowel (> 15 mm in length and 7 mm in diameter) suggests fetal bowel obstruction.
Bowel diameter > 10 mm after 26 weeks’ gestation is considered abnormally dilated.

Amniotic uid index
PREPARATION
Empty bladder.
POSITION
Mother is in the supine position. The uterus is divided into four quad­rants using the maternal sagittal midline vertically and an arbitrary trans­verse line across the umbilicus.
TRANSDUCER
Transabdominal: 3.0–6.0 MHz curvilinear transducer.
METHOD
The transducer is parallel to the maternal sagittal plane, and perpen­dicular to the maternal coronal plane. The deepest, unobstructed clear pocket of amniotic uid is taken from each quadrant and is measured in vertical direction.
The amniotic uid index is sum of the maximum vertical depths of the amniotic uid pockets in the four quadrants.
The amniotic uid index can be used to determine the volume of amni­otic uid after 16 weeks.
APPEARANCE
The deepest pocket of amniotic uid in each quadrant is visualized. The pocket should be free of umbilical cord and fetal extremities.
